Esmark Inc., Wheeling, W.Va., has announced the completion of its acquisition by OAO Severstal.
The acquisition was completed pursuant to the merger of Severstal Wheeling Acquisition Corp., a wholly-owned subsidiary of Severstal, with and into Esmark. Esmark was the surviving corporation of the merger and is now an indirect, wholly-owned subsidiary of Severstal and has been renamed “Severstal Wheeling Holding Company.”
With the completion of the tender offer and consummation of the merger, Severstal acquired all of Esmark's businesses, including:
• Wheeling-Pittsburgh Steel Corporation (to be renamed “Severstal
Wheeling, Inc.”)
• Esmark Steel Service Group, Inc. (to be renamed “Northern Steel
Group, Inc.”)
• Remaining 50 percent ownership of the joint venture Mountain State Carbon,
LLC, a blast furnace coking coal facility in West Virginia.
Esmark Inc. is a producer of carbon flat-rolled products for the construction, container, appliance, converter/processor, steel service center, automotive and other markets. The company’s products include various sheet products such as hot rolled, cold rolled, hot dipped galvanized, electro-galvanized, black plate and electrolytic tinplate.
